AI System Aims to Combat Bovine Respiratory Disease in Calves
A new AI-enabled monitoring system has the potential to significantly enhance the health of dairy calves by addressing the major threat of Bovine Respiratory Disease (BRD). This condition, a form of pneumonia, stands as the leading cause of death among dairy calves once they transition from their mothers’ milk to solid food. The economic impact of BRD on the U.S. cattle industry exceeds $1 billion annually, highlighting the urgent need for effective solutions.
Innovative technology is at the forefront of this initiative. The AI system utilizes real-time data to monitor various health indicators in calves, allowing farmers to identify early signs of respiratory issues. By continuously analyzing factors such as temperature, breathing patterns, and activity levels, the system aims to facilitate timely interventions. This proactive approach could drastically reduce the mortality rate associated with BRD and improve overall herd health.
